MOUNT PLEASANT, Mich. - The Central Michigan volleyball team dropped a Mid-American Conference five-setter against Eastern Michigan on Thursday at McGuirk Arena.
The loss snapped the Chippewas' five-game win streak as they fell to 15-12, 7-8 MAC.
CMU look to secure a place in the MAC tournament in its final match of the regular-season on the road against Ohio on Saturday (7 p.m.). The top eight teams in the overall conference standings make the league tournament. CMU entered Thursday's match in a three-way tie for sixth place.
"Losing in five stinks," said CMU coach Mike Gawlik, who saw his team squander a 2-0 lead.
